Enhanced Functionality and Comfort
One of the most considerable advantages of dental implants is the remediation of functionality. Unlike dentures, which can slip or trigger pain, dental implants are firmly anchored into the jawbone. This makes them work similar to natural teeth, supplying stability while eating, speaking, and carrying out daily activities.
For those who have experienced the frustration of uncomfortable dentures, dental implants provide a welcome modification. Considering that implants are surgically put into the bone, they supply a steady foundation for crowns, bridges, or dentures, making sure a tight fit. You no longer require to stress over your teeth shifting out of location, allowing you to enjoy your favorite foods without limitation.
Natural Appearance
Oral implants are designed to simulate the feel and look of natural teeth, making them a great option for those who wish to restore their smile to its natural appearance. The implant itself is a titanium post that is placed into the jawbone, and the replacement tooth (generally a crown) is created to match the color, shape, and size of your surrounding teeth.
The outcome is a smooth, aesthetically pleasing smile that looks and feels totally natural. Unlike dentures or bridges, which might sometimes appear large or unnatural, dental implants offer a more discreet and comfortable alternative that is virtually identical from your genuine teeth.
Long-Term Durability and Longevity
Dental implants are understood for their toughness. The titanium material used for the implant incorporates with the jawbone in a procedure called osseointegration, which strengthens the bond between the implant and bone tissue.
In comparison, dentures need to be changed or relined every few years, and bridges normally require to be changed every 10 to 15 years. The long-term toughness of dental implants makes them an excellent financial investment in your oral health and quality of life.
Prevention of Bone Loss
When a tooth is lost, the underlying jawbone can start to weaken due to the fact that it no longer receives stimulation from the tooth's roots. Over time, this can cause a loss of bone density and a change in facial appearance.
This is a typical problem with standard dentures, which do not supply the needed stimulation to the bone.
Oral implants, on the other hand, stimulate the jawbone in similar way natural tooth roots do. The titanium post fuses with the bone, avoiding bone loss and maintaining the integrity of the jaw structure.

No Need to Change Nearby Teeth.
Among the crucial benefits of oral implants is that they do not need changing or harming adjacent healthy teeth. When it comes to dental bridges, for example, the surrounding teeth may need to be shaved down to support the bridge. This can jeopardize the health of those teeth and make them more susceptible to decay.
With dental implants, the surrounding teeth remain untouched. The implant is placed directly into the jawbone, and a crown is placed on top. This maintains the natural structure of your teeth while providing a secure and lasting replacement for the missing tooth.
Better Oral Health
Dental implants are beneficial not simply for the look of your smile however also for your general oral health. Missing teeth can make it more difficult to chew and speak correctly, which can result in further oral problems. Individuals with missing out on teeth may prevent particular foods, which can result in dietary shortages.
Additionally, missing teeth can cause the surrounding teeth to move out of positioning, leading to bite problems. Oral implants assist restore correct alignment and functionality, improving both your oral health and quality of life.
Because oral implants are positioned in the jawbone, they do not put tension on surrounding teeth or gums, reducing the risk of further damage. Implants are much easier to care for compared to bridges or dentures. They can be cleaned up similar to natural teeth, with routine brushing and flossing, assisting you keep great oral health.

Improved Speech
Missing teeth or uncomfortable dentures can impact your ability to speak plainly. When teeth are missing, it can impact your capability to pronounce certain words, causing speech troubles. In addition, dentures may trigger slurring or clicking noises while talking. Oral implants are securely placed in the jaw, providing a steady foundation for speaking. This makes sure that your speech remains clear and natural, enabling you to communicate with confidence without worrying about your teeth slipping or impacting your speech.
Cost-Effectiveness in the Long Run
While dental implants may initially seem more costly than other tooth replacement alternatives, they are more affordable in the long run. Considering that they last a life time with appropriate care, you won't need to change them every couple of years as you would with dentures or bridges. In addition, the requirement for less oral check outs and upkeep costs makes dental implants a wise long-term investment in your oral health.
